GROTON, Conn. – In its final event before the Great Northeast Athletic Conference (GNAC) Championship, the Albertus Magnus College men's golf team finished first out of four teams at the Mitchell Invite III, hosted at the Shennecossett Golf Club in Groton, Conn.
The Falcons finished five strokes clear of second-place New England College with a team score of 319. The victory is AMC's fourth this season.
TEAM SCORES
1. Albertus Magnus – 319
2. New England College – 324
3. Wentworth – 327
4. Mitchell – 334
NOTES
• Shamar Wilson (Montego Bay, Jamaica) led the way for the Falcons, finishing one stroke shy of earning medalist honors with a three-over 74 for second place.
• Wilson has carded a sub-80 score in all but one round he has played this season.
• The duo of David Aquavia (Oakville, Conn.) and Devin Hines (West Haven, Conn.) placed next for Albertus, as the pair both finished with identical scores of 80 (+9) to tie for seventh on the leaderboard.
• Kyle Sikorski (Norwich, Conn.) was the next Falcon on the leaderboard in 13th place with his 85 (+14) round.
• Robert Eichelberger (Odessa, Fla.) finished fifth on AMC after carding a 90 (+19) to place 17th.
